#521bd6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#521bd6 is composed of 32.2% red, 10.6%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.7% cyan, 87.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 257.6 degrees, a saturation of 77.6% and a lightness of 47.3%. #521bd6 color hex could be obtained by blending #a436ff with #0000ad.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#521bd6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020105 is the darkest color, while #f6f3f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#521bd6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787879 is the less saturated color, while #4a08e9 is the most saturated one.
